This are some notes to install OS/2 Warp 4 as a guest OS on VirtualBox.

If you are looking to install OS/2 Warp 4.52 or eComStation as a Virtualbox guest please visit VirtualBox Guest.

Installation Notes

If you are trying to install OS/2 Warp 4 (revision 9.023) it is useful for you to get a set of updated diskette images for the Installation Disk 1 and Disk 2. This is important to support bigger hard drivers like 2GB. (or on this case bigger virtual HDD images).

Installing VirtualBox Guest Addons

Without any Warp 4 fixpacks installed, if you want to install VirtualBox Guest Add-ons according to the instrucctions you may get this errors.

When VBOXGUEST.SYS loads on the boot:

Also, when trying load "VBoxService.exe" from Startup.cmd you will get an error that TCPIP32 was not found.

You require to install a fixpack to make that applications work. On this case I installed Fixpack 15.
